For today I only have teaser pictures, I plan on doing the install tomorrow if I have time... I'm also going to do a FULL write-up with pics, I didn't find any on here... I'm going to be installing the 55 shot for now, the kit has a choice between 55, 65, and 75, but they recommend some ign retarding for the last two... I will be using this same fourm for the write up for those that are interested...

My system contains the following:
Zex Wet Nitrous System - for Scion tC
Bottle Pressure Gauge
Nitrous Purge Kit
Rapid-Fire Purge add-on Controller with Blue LED
New Spark Plugs (Buying these tomorrow when I fill the tank)

Kind of give you an idea with numbers:

Here are my numbers without spray:

Reaction: .2419
60 ft: 2.3041
1/8 ET: 10.1011
1/8 MPH: 71.29
1000' ET: 13.0891
1/4 ET: 15.6233
1/4 MPH: 89.10

Here are the numbers with the 75 Shot:

Reaction: .5682
60 ft: 2.4277
1/8 ET: 9.8038
1/8 MPH: 9.8038
1000' ET: 12.5219
1/4 ET: 14.7898
1/4 MPH: 98.92

Plus I ran a 55shot, then a 65shot, and finally a 75shot for awhile and never had a problem. Good Luck you should be fine.

Ummm Yaa... Whoever wrote down a Quick 2-Hour instal in the manual -> ... I'm about 85% done, almost 12 Hours later!... I still need to run the hose from the bottle in the trunk to the Control Unit, also wire up the purge with power and a switch... The Nitrous kit itself is all done under the hood and wired up... I have a total of 56 Pictures so far but here is a quick few teasers again...

Check out the Purge, took a little work to make the pipe like that (it comes in the box as about 12 straight inches). Doesn't interfear with the hood closing or anything around it - I got a lot further than whats in this picture
